Teacher Volunteering Program

Opportunity for Certificate Based Teacher Volunteering Program for all the Teachers / Staff of Govt. / Private Schools of Delhi

The Directorate of Education in association with Ladli Foundation Trust- an international level Non-Profit Organization, having Special Consultative Status In United Nations, has designed a exceptional volunteering program to provide an opportunity to all the teachers of Delhi to participate in activities aligned towards flagship initiatives of the Government and United Nations Sustainable Development Goals, by earning the community service volunteering certification / International recognition to strengthen their profile.

The program is designed to perform volunteering activities within the school premises by organizing the workshops with the students / parents to sensitize them on most concerning issues such as- Malnutrition, Child Sexual Abuse, Menstrual Hygiene Management, Gender Sensitization, Prevention of Communicable Diseases, Drugs and Substance Abuse, Cyber Crimes, Digital Literacy etc.

This opportunity is open for all the teachers, vice principals, Principals, administration staff, who are serving in Govt. & Private Schools of Delhi.

Duration & Workshops:-

  1. The certificate-oriented volunteering program is scheduled for completion by March 31, 2024
  2. Participants have the flexibility to arrange 1 to 2 workshops based on relevant subjects at their convenience.
  3. Each workshop conducted and its subsequent report submission will be acknowledged as 10 hours of volunteering activity.

Benefits, Awards and Recognition:

  1. One Subject/ Activity Specific Volunteering certificate will be awarded for each successfully submitted workshop
  2. Throughout the program, a participant's engagement and performance can achieve a maximum of 10 certificates.
  3. Participants obtaining 8 Volunteering Certificates will qualify for an Additional Commendation Certificate conferred by the esteemed Director of Education.
  4. Participants obtaining 9 Volunteering Certificates will be entitled to a distinguished place on the Roll of Honor, bestowed by the esteemed Director of Education.
  5. Participants successfully achieving all 10 Volunteering Certificates will be considered for Letter of Recommendations / Nominations for State, National, or International Level Awards.

Month Wise Timeline

  1. November 2023 – Malnutrition, Tuberculosis, HIV/AIDS and Drugs Abuse
  2. December 2023 - Cyber Crimes and Child Abuse
  3. January 2024 - Menstrual Hygiene Management and Gender Sensitization
  4. February 2024 – Water, sanitation and hygiene (WASH) & Digital Empowerment.
  5. March 2024 –Impact Assessment, Report Development / Submission
